1. Bodyweight Circuit

  • Description: A fast-paced circuit using your body weight to strengthen and tone.
  • Setup:
    • Jumping Jacks: 30 seconds
    • Push-Ups: 10 reps
    • Bodyweight Squats: 15 reps
    • Mountain Climbers: 30 seconds
  • Sets: 3 sets
  • Rest: 45 seconds between sets
  • Form Cue: Keep your back straight during squats.
  • Modification: Perform push-ups on your knees for easier variation.

2. HIIT Full Body Blast

  • Description: High-Intensity Interval Training to maximize calorie burn.
  • Setup:
    • Burpees: 30 seconds
    • High Knees: 30 seconds
    • Plank Jacks: 30 seconds
    • Rest: 15 seconds
  • Sets: 4 sets
  • Rest: 1 minute between rounds
  • Form Cue: Land softly on your feet when jumping.
  • Modification: Step out instead of jumping for plank jacks.

3. Tabata Training

  • Description: 20 seconds of work followed by 10 seconds of rest, repeated.
  • Setup:
    • Squat Jumps: 20 seconds
    • Push-Ups: 20 seconds
    • Lunges: 20 seconds
    • Sit-Ups: 20 seconds
  • Sets: 8 rounds (4 minutes total)
  • Rest: 1 minute between exercises
  • Form Cue: Keep your knees behind your toes during lunges.
  • Modification: Perform regular squats instead of jumps.

4. Resistance Band Workout

  • Description: Use a resistance band to enhance muscle engagement.
  • Setup:
    • Band Squats: 12 reps
    • Band Chest Press: 12 reps
    • Band Rows: 12 reps
  • Sets: 3 sets
  • Rest: 45 seconds between sets
  • Form Cue: Squeeze the band tightly during chest press.
  • Modification: Use a lighter band for easier resistance.

5. Pilates Fusion

  • Description: Low-impact, core-focused workout.
  • Setup:
    • The Hundred: 30 seconds
    • Plank: 30 seconds
    • Leg Circles: 15 reps each leg
  • Sets: 3 sets
  • Rest: 30 seconds between sets
  • Form Cue: Keep your shoulders away from your ears during plank.
  • Modification: Perform the hundred with feet on the ground.

6. Yoga Flow

  • Description: Full-body stretch combined with strength.
  • Setup:
    • Downward Dog: 30 seconds
    • Warrior II: 30 seconds each side
    • Chair Pose: 30 seconds
  • Sets: 3 sets
  • Rest: 30 seconds between sets
  • Form Cue: Keep your front knee over your ankle in Warrior II.
  • Modification: Reduce the depth of the chair pose for less intensity.

7. Core and Cardio Combo

  • Description: Strengthening and cardio in one.
  • Setup:
    • Russian Twists: 15 reps each side
    • Jump Rope (or mimic): 1 minute
    • Plank: 30 seconds
  • Sets: 3 sets
  • Rest: 45 seconds between sets
  • Form Cue: Keep your back straight during twists.
  • Modification: Perform twists with feet on the ground.

8. Circuit with Household Items

  • Description: Use what you have at home for resistance.
  • Setup:
    • Water Bottle Curls: 10 reps
    • Chair Dips: 10 reps
    • Towel Rows: 12 reps
  • Sets: 3 sets
  • Rest: 45 seconds between sets
  • Form Cue: Keep elbows close to your body during curls.
  • Modification: Use lighter bottles or skip weights entirely.

9. Agility Ladder Drills

  • Description: Improve speed and coordination.
  • Setup:
    • In-and-Outs: 30 seconds
    • Lateral Shuffles: 30 seconds
    • Single-Leg Hops: 30 seconds each leg
  • Sets: 3 sets
  • Rest: 45 seconds between sets
  • Form Cue: Keep your knees soft while shuffling.
  • Modification: Perform shuffles without an agility ladder.

10. Stretch and Strength

  • Description: Combine stretching with strength movements.
  • Setup:
    • Cat-Cow Stretch: 30 seconds
    • Glute Bridges: 12 reps
    • Side Plank: 20 seconds each side
  • Sets: 3 sets
  • Rest: 30 seconds between sets
  • Form Cue: Squeeze your glutes at the top of the bridge.
  • Modification: Lower your hips in the side plank for less intensity.

Cool-Down Section (3-5 minutes)

  • Child’s Pose: 1 minute
  • Seated Forward Fold: 1 minute
  • Torso Twist: 30 seconds each side
  • Deep Breaths: 1 minute
